ORLANDO — Universal Orlando Resort has opened the books on its newest on-site hotel, Loews Sapphire Falls Resort.

Built around a lush, tropical lagoon and towering waterfall, the new, 1,000-room Caribbean-themed hideaway is the fifth hotel at Universal Orlando and will bring the number of on-site hotel rooms to 5,200. The property will feature Universal Orlando’s largest on-site, zero-entry pool at 16,000 square-feet, with a white sand beach, a water slide, cabanas and fire pit.

Dining options will include Amatista Cookhouse, a Caribbean-inspired restaurant with open exhibition kitchen and outdoor dining; Strong Water Tavern, a destination lobby lounge overlooking the hotel’s towering waterfalls and offering a tapas-style menu; Drhum Club Kantine, a poolside bar and grill; New Dutch Trading Co., a quick-service marketplace off the lobby; and 24-hour room service.

Value season rates start at US$119 per night for a seven-night stay or $143 per night for a four-night stay. Summer season rates are from $176 per night for a seven-night stay or $206 per night for a four-night stay. Guest benefits include early theme park admission, complimentary water taxi service and shuttle bus transportation to the theme parks and Universal CityWalk, complimentary delivery of merchandise purchased throughout the resort to their hotel and resort-wide charging privileges.
